At the NASCAR Annual awards, the 2021 Cup Series champion, Kyle Larson had a night to remember. The Hendrick driver was honored by the NASCAR community after his historic season. But Larson also made sure that he thanked those who have helped him reach where he is now.
The 29-year-old driver thanked all the key cogs in his success, one of which, and probably the most important one was his wife, Katelyn Larson. And one thing that came out clear after Larson’s message for his wife is that the champ knows how to hit them in the feels and make them laugh at the same time.
“I’m lucky to spend this life with you, Katelyn. Even though I’m not sure how I feel about you stealing thunder in victory lane while you shotgun your beers,” Larson said as the crowd laughed.

Kyle Larson took a moment to thank Chip Ganassi for his faith
After thanking those who were instrumental in his success, Larson thanked Chip Ganassi, without whom his NASCAR career wouldn’t even exist. Larson recalled his time coming off from dirt racing a decade ago.
He said, “Back in 2012, as a relatively unknown racer from California, I went to North Carolina and met with a lot of the teams in here tonight. I remember feeling defeated as we headed to CGR expecting the same sort of conversation.”
